How to Remove Hard Water Stains from Shower Glass

Author: Ken Christopher | 3 min read | Aug 26, 2025

Hard water stains on shower glass can be a frustrating and unsightly problem, but with the right approach and tools, you can easily restore your shower’s sparkle. Here’s a comprehensive guide on how to effectively remove hard water stains and prevent them from returning.

Understanding Hard Water Stains

Hard water stains are the result of mineral deposits, primarily calcium and magnesium, left behind when water evaporates. Over time, these stains can build up and become increasingly difficult to remove. Tools and Ingredients for Stain Removal

Household Remedies

  1. White Vinegar: An effective natural cleaner that dissolves mineral deposits.
  2. Baking Soda: Used in combination with vinegar for tough stains.
  3. Lemon Juice: The acidity helps to break down build-up.
  4. Commercial Cleaners: Look for products specifically designed to tackle hard water stains.

Steps to Remove Hard Water Stains

  1. Preparation: Gather your cleaning tools and solutions.
  2. Apply Solution: Spray or wipe a generous amount of white vinegar on the stained areas.
  3. Wait: Allow the vinegar to sit for 10–15 minutes to break down mineral deposits.
  4. Scrub: Use a non-abrasive scrubber or sponge to gently remove the stains.
  5. Rinse: Thoroughly rinse the glass with warm water.
  6. Dry: Use a microfiber cloth to dry the glass completely, reducing water spots.

Frequently Asked Questions

What are the best methods to remove hard water stains from shower glass?

Using a mixture of white vinegar and baking soda is one of the most effective and natural methods. You can also use commercial cleaners designed for hard water stains.

How often should I clean my shower glass to prevent hard water buildup?

Regular cleaning at least once a week can help maintain clear glass and prevent buildup.

Will using a water softener solve all my hard water problems?

While a water softener significantly helps reduce hard water issues, regular cleaning and maintenance are still necessary to keep your shower glass spotless.
